Entry Tax exempted for replacement of furniture & goods destroyed due to floods
Jammu, January 27, (Scoop News)-As ordered by the Governor, N.N. Vohra, the Finance Department has issued SRO 22 exempting payment of Entry Tax leviable under “Entry Tax on Goods Act, 2000”, (Act No. IV of 2000) on furniture, office equipment and goods imported into the State by Hoteliers to replace for such goods as were destroyed during the recent floods. The exemption shall be available upto 28th February 2015.


A Raj Bhavan Spokesman added that this exemption shall be available only in respect of Hoteliers who shall apply to Director Tourism of the concerned Division with a list of the goods and the quantities damaged during the floods in 2014. The concerned Director, after satisfying himself that such goods, claimed as replacement under the aforesaid SRO, were damaged due to the 2014 floods and, inter-alia, verify the Insurance Claims and other relevant documents in support of the claims made by the applicants, within seven days from the receipt of the applications from Hoteliers, and furnish his recommendations to Commissioner Commercial Taxes who, in turn, shall settle the issue on merits within three days.


It is envisaged that this exemption will enable early revival of tourism infrastructure damaged during the recent floods, the Spokesman added.
